chiark
/
gitweb
/
~ianmdlvl
/
otter.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
apitest: Provide @examples@
[otter.git]
/
src
/
2021-05-17
Ian Jackson
progress: Flush so the progress info is actually timely
tree
|
commitdiff
2021-05-17
Ian Jackson
if_let: Remove the "match" from the general case
tree
|
commitdiff
2021-05-17
Ian Jackson
bundles: Print the bundle name after we have uploaded it
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Minor change to byte count output formatting
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Use threads to do concurrent progress reports.
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Make ProgressMode come from MgmtChannel
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Introduce ProgressMode
tree
|
commitdiff
2021-05-17
Ian Jackson
Revert "progress: Disable the upload progress for now"
tree
|
commitdiff
2021-05-17
Ian Jackson
bundles progress: Rework to do the duplex disablement...
tree
|
commitdiff
2021-05-17
Ian Jackson
mgmtchannel: Add threadsafety bounds to the bulk writer
tree
|
commitdiff
2021-05-17
Ian Jackson
packetframe: Use concrete types in two places
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Call termprogress::clear() before examining...
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Provide termprogress::clear()
tree
|
commitdiff
2021-05-17
Ian Jackson
progress: Make cmd_withbulk take termprogress::Reporter...
tree
|
commitdiff
2021-05-17
Ian Jackson
bundles: Truncate bundle files before deleting them
tree
|
commitdiff
2021-05-17
Ian Jackson
bundles: Break out scan_game_bundles
tree
|
commitdiff
2021-05-17
Ian Jackson
bundles: A todo
tree
|
commitdiff
2021-05-17
Ian Jackson
cmdlistener: Apply an idle timeout and an upload timeout
tree
|
commitdiff
2021-05-17
Ian Jackson
cmdlistener: Use a concrete type for the read stream
tree
|
commitdiff
2021-05-17
Ian Jackson
Reader access: Add some methods to get at the inner...
tree
|
commitdiff
2021-05-17
Ian Jackson
timedread: Remove some unnecessary braces
tree
|
commitdiff
2021-05-17
Ian Jackson
mgmtchannel: Change contained type to a TimedFdReader
tree
|
commitdiff
2021-05-17
Ian Jackson
timedfd: Add note re nonblock open-file
tree
|
commitdiff
2021-05-17
Ian Jackson
timedfd: Provide TimedFdWriter too
tree
|
commitdiff
2021-05-17
Ian Jackson
timedfd: Refactor to prep for writing too (2)
tree
|
commitdiff
2021-05-17
Ian Jackson
timedfd: Refactor to prep for writing too (1)
tree
|
commitdiff
2021-05-17
Ian Jackson
timedfd: Rename from timedread
tree
|
commitdiff
2021-05-17
Ian Jackson
timedread: Add to prelude
tree
|
commitdiff
2021-05-17
Ian Jackson
timedread: Retry on EINTR from poll
tree
|
commitdiff
2021-05-17
Ian Jackson
packetframe: Fuse: Do not persist EINTR or EWOULDBLOCK
tree
|
commitdiff
2021-05-17
Ian Jackson
timereader: Minor refactoring
tree
|
commitdiff
2021-05-17
Ian Jackson
timereader: Provide useful methods
tree
|
commitdiff
2021-05-17
Ian Jackson
timereader: New module - does not work properly yet
tree
|
commitdiff
2021-05-16
Ian Jackson
packetframe: Provide get_even_broken method
tree
|
commitdiff
2021-05-16
Ian Jackson
packetframe: Fuse: retain the inner RW when broken
tree
|
commitdiff
2021-05-16
Ian Jackson
mgmtchannel: Drop BufReader and BufWriter
tree
|
commitdiff
2021-05-16
Ian Jackson
progress: Disable the upload progress for now
tree
|
commitdiff
2021-05-15
Ian Jackson
Drop some done todos
tree
|
commitdiff
2021-05-15
Ian Jackson
Drop some todos: Library listing
tree
|
commitdiff
2021-05-15
Ian Jackson
Drop a todo: MultiSpec
tree
|
commitdiff
2021-05-15
Ian Jackson
errors: Abolish obsolete MgmtError::GameCorrupted
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Dedup library items before adding them
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: No, we don't need to delete them, they'll...
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Punt on src field in metadata
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Show bundle in library information
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Uwe the prelude alias for ItemSpec
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Provide and use ItemEnquiryData -> ItemSpec
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Put LibraryEnquiryData in ItemEnquiryData
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Put *EnquiryData in the prelude
tree
|
commitdiff
2021-05-15
Ian Jackson
library listing: Rework library patterns
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Change to fehler in a function
tree
|
commitdiff
2021-05-15
Ian Jackson
library listing: Provide for listing libs on the server...
tree
|
commitdiff
2021-05-15
Ian Jackson
ItemEnquiryData: Put the lib name in it
tree
|
commitdiff
2021-05-15
Ian Jackson
ItemEnquiryData: format it with Display, not an ad...
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ib;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
command: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
gamestate: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
spec: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Further improve error printing
tree
|
commitdiff
2021-05-15
Ian Jackson
otter: Do not panic on (most) command execution errors
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Check outline is valid
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Note a bug!
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Actually implement shape loading
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Break out Registry::add()
tree
|
commitdiff
2021-05-15
Ian Jackson
shapelib: Provide per-game registry iterator
tree
|
commitdiff
2021-05-15
Ian Jackson
Make library list a per-table thing at managemnet API
tree
|
commitdiff
2021-05-15
Ian Jackson
lib enquiries: Some todos
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Reset the access key on clear
tree
|
commitdiff
2021-05-15
Ian Jackson
occult ilks: Rename insert() to create()
tree
|
commitdiff
2021-05-15
Ian Jackson
occult ilks: Fix dispose to actually work! (Fixes...
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: clear: When unexpected leftover stuff, print it
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Provide otter(1) clear-game
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Minor code tidying, including a new type alias
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Implement ClearBundles
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Write a comment about bundle states
tree
|
commitdiff
2021-05-15
Ian Jackson
Provide .is_empty() for many types
tree
|
commitdiff
2021-05-15
Ian Jackson
Revert "libraries: LibraryItemNotPrepared: Make this...
tree
|
commitdiff
2021-05-15
Ian Jackson
Revert "Revert "libraries: Prepare for multiple librari...
tree
|
commitdiff
2021-05-15
Ian Jackson
Piece traits: Pass ig and depth rather than PieceAliases
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Plumb libs into incorporate_bundle
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Drop various traits from Parsed
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Note some todos
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Remove a not-needed layer of references
tree
|
commitdiff
2021-05-15
Ian Jackson
progress: Fix width of RHS bar
tree
|
commitdiff
2021-05-15
Ian Jackson
progress: Minor presentation improvements
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Use new size and ReadReporter to show upload...
tree
|
commitdiff
2021-05-15
Ian Jackson
bundles: Pass size through
tree
|
commitdiff
2021-05-15
Ian Jackson
progress: provide ReadOriginator (untested as yet)
tree
|
commitdiff
2021-05-14
Ian Jackson
progress: Provide test mode for progress bars
tree
|
commitdiff
2021-05-14
Ian Jackson
progress: Improve progress bars
tree
|
commitdiff
2021-05-14
Ian Jackson
progress: Print progress bars in otter(1) bundle upload
tree
|
commitdiff
2021-05-13
Ian Jackson
progress: Rename Originator (from Reporter)
tree
|
commitdiff
2021-05-13
Ian Jackson
bundles: Skip indices of .tmp's on reload
tree
|
commitdiff
2021-05-13
Ian Jackson
bundles: Pieces: Actually note in need_svgs
tree
|
commitdiff
2021-05-13
Ian Jackson
bundles: Pieces: fix order of return values from rsplit
tree
|
commitdiff
2021-05-13
Ian Jackson
bundles: Initial code for processing svgs
tree
|
commitdiff
2021-05-13
Ian Jackson
config: Provide libexec_dir and usvg_bin
tree
|
commitdiff
next